ASM (Transport Manager)

Here you can specify ASM entries to be transferred to the target system. Note: Changes made in the meantime are not updated in the list. You can force an update to the latest versions using the context menu ("Refresh entries").

(1) Window left and (2) window right: You first have to select a client for both systems.

(3) Window left: Select ASM entries to be transferred.

(4) Window right: Select target group or ASM entry if it is to be replaced (5).

(5) Overwrite on target system: If the ASM entry is to be replaced.

(6) New name: A new name for the target ASM entry can be assigned here.

(7) Add job: Click here to create the job.

(8) Execute transport jobs: Click here to execute the job. See also (9).

(9) Window below: Alternatively to (8), a schedule can be created via the context menu ("Create scheduled task for this list").
